Aspidistra Plant Care And Tips
Aspidistra Plant Care Tips -
1. Aspidistras are very slow growing and shade loving plants so it can be cultivated as indoor plants where the sunlight is low.
2. Not only indoor, the beautiful leafy plant can be potted outside the house preferably in a shaded area.
3. Any loamy, well drained soil with plenty of organic matter will favor the growth of these plants.
4. For good growth, use liquid fertilizers for aspidistras just once a month during spring and summer.
5. Aspidistra plants grow in clumps so divide the rhizomatous roots in spring and plant a section of rhizome with a leaf to grow new aspidistras in the garden.
6. Do not water these plants too much as moist soil is more than enough for their growth. The plants can even survive in drought conditions.
7. If the green leaves are found going dull then place in light until they regain the color.
8. Decayed manure, humus or peat can be good fertilizers for these plants to grow well in the outdoors.
Use these aspidistra plant care tips to grow these lovely plants that will make both your indoor and outdoor decor look green, healthy and fresh.
